How We Work
1
Immediate Contact
Your call connects you directly with a certified technician. We gather initial details about the water damage and dispatch a rapid response team to your Asheville property. Quick action prevents further damage.
2
Damage Assessment
Upon arrival, our team uses specialized moisture meters and thermal imaging to accurately assess the extent of water intrusion. This detailed inspection informs our custom drying plan and identifies all affected areas.
3
Water Extraction
Powerful industrial-grade extractors remove standing water quickly. We then strategically place high-volume air movers and dehumidifiers to begin the thorough drying process, preventing mold growth.
4
Drying & Monitoring
We continuously monitor temperature, humidity, and moisture levels. Our team makes necessary adjustments to equipment, ensuring optimal drying conditions until structural materials are completely dry and safe.
5
Restoration & Repair
Once fully dry, we proceed with any necessary repairs or reconstruction. Our goal is to return your property to its pre-damage condition, completing the restoration with a final quality check.

Warning Signs You Need Foundation Leak Water Removal

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don't ignore these warning signs, call us today to schedule a consultation and get the help you need.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Yellow or brown water stains on your walls or ceiling can show a foundation leak. If you notice these stains, it's essential to act quickly to prevent further damage.

Musty Odors That Won't Go Away

A musty smell in your home can be a sign of a foundation leak. These odors can be a sign of mold growth, which can spread quickly and cause serious health issues.

Water Damage in the Basement or Crawlspace

Water damage in these areas can be a sign of a foundation leak. If you notice water damage in your basement or crawlspace, it's crucial to act quickly to prevent further damage.

Cracks in the Foundation or Walls

Cracks in the foundation or walls can show a foundation leak. These cracks can be a sign of structural damage, which can cause serious problems if left unaddressed.

Water Leaks Under the House or Behind Walls

Water leaks under the house or behind walls can be a sign of a foundation leak. These leaks can be difficult to detect, but it's essential to act quickly to prevent further damage.

Foundation Leak Water Removal Cost in Bryson City, NC

The cost of foundation leak water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Bryson City, NC. These estimates are based on our experience and are subject to change based on the specifics of your job.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Moisture Detection and Assessment $200 - $1,000 The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area affect the cost of this service.
Water Removal and Cleanup $500 - $5,000 The amount of water to be removed and the complexity of the job affect the cost of this service.
Drying and Monitoring $500 - $2,000 The size of the affected area and the number of days required for drying affect the cost of this service.
Final Inspection and Restoration $500 - $2,000 The complexity of the job and the number of repairs required affect the cost of this service.
Containment and Drying $500 - $2,000 The size of the affected area and the complexity of the job affect the cost of this service.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ates to ensure you get the best possible price for your job.
